LAHORE: PML-N MPAs Mian Jalil Ahmad Sharqpuri and Faisal Khan Niazi called on Chief Minister Usman Buzdar at his office on Saturday and discussed issues related to their constituencies.

In a meeting with Mr Sharqpuri, the chief minister condemned the incident that took place in the Punjab Assembly with him.

Mr Sharqpuri apprised the chief minister about the problems in his constituency.

The chief minister assured the MPA of resolving the issues. He said he was saddened over the ill-treatment meted out to Sharaqpuri in the Punjab Assembly. He said the behaviour of opposition members was reprehensible and regrettable.

Similarly, MPA Niazi apprised the chief minister about the problems in his constituency, public welfare projects and development schemes. The chief minister noted the suggestions and assured that issues would be resolved at the earliest.

Mr Buzdar said MPAs were highly respectable for him and added that the rulers of the past used to marginalise all power to themselves through the One Man Show but his doors were always open for MPAs.

He said the opposition parties were trying to divide the nation but the people of Pakistan were well-aware and would never be hoodwinked by corrupt elements.

Both MPAs expressed their confidence in the chief minister.
